Fix printing of types in initializers with suppressed tags.
Tag and specifier printing can be suppressed in Decl::printGroup, but these suppressions leak into the initializers. Thus
int *x = ((void *)0), *y = ((void *)0);
gets printed as
int *x = ((void *)0), *y = ((*)0);
And
struct { struct Z z; } z = {(struct Z){}};
gets printed as
struct { struct Z z; } z = {(){}};
The stops the suppressions from leaking into the initializers.
